Posted on 10-01-05 09:48 AM Link | Quote
Originally posted by Doubledanger
does anyone have any good tips for saving gas
start driving 65 on the freeways

I used to drive 80mph on the freeways and the most milage my car got was around 224 by the time the tank was running on fumes. When I started to drive at 65, milage went from 224 to 325 when it ran on fumes.
